Как веб-сервер обрабатывает блокировку (ожидание и сигнал) запроса между вызовами API? - PullRequest
0 голосов
/ 08 июля 2019

Нам поручено реализовать API REST: 1 для удержания запроса, 1 для отмены запроса и остальные для промежуточной обработки.

Учитывая, что эти вызовы API находятся на веб-сервереи они вызываются по отдельному запросу. Может ли signal () соответствовать запросу, находящемуся в режиме ожидания (состояние ожидания)?

Пожалуйста, помогите!Есть кое-что, что я не получаю здесь.Заранее спасибо!

hold(){ 
    hold.await();
}

inBetween(){
    // do some processing
}

release(){
    hold.signal();
}
...